Transaction 7870fdeee95c660a070829196d4dd392eebdc131b01bf1946d7cb95de576e3a6

1 Input
2 Outputs
  • 7870fdeee95c660a070829196d4dd392eebdc131b01bf1946d7cb95de576e3a6:0
  • value  1198305
    address  1GBfJEryJx7DvtTiNWGrU3WhxmjJfWvrQM
  • 7870fdeee95c660a070829196d4dd392eebdc131b01bf1946d7cb95de576e3a6:1
  • value  8105647037
    address  1FubZrkhUn6aESDavCwd3cEwiutpt621eB